Output b628581c267bf1958687d50205fac25880d4f9e59ff0a91e8a27ba084780bc58:1

value
622860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88d87e7a5619982a0ad2460bf60e27bcd873088d OP_EQUAL
address
3EAbAuLuYBm1qVK7GFqxsvPB2ncpCku5Y1
transaction
b628581c267bf1958687d50205fac25880d4f9e59ff0a91e8a27ba084780bc58